The 5000m2 ceiling at the NZ Post Mail Centre in Palmerston North has 80mm C Max Absorb tiles in the suspended ceiling grid. The entire ceiling is seismically designed to be floating at the edges and the 80mm tile has great thermal performance.

T&R Interior Systems specialise in the supply of quality interior building and acoustic products fully supported by extensive technical support and friendly service. We offer expert interior acoustic solutions, luminaires, partition walls and ceilings. T&R are passionate about correct seismic design for non-structural elements.

T&R are constantly re-evaluating and developing new innovative ideas to improve acoustic environments and make safer interiors. Our product range is dynamic reflecting the latest research, while our core products have a long in-service history throughout New Zealand. Our systems are continuously refined, evaluated, tested and developed to solve problems and find solutions. We are proud to have relationships with Canterbury University, JSK Acoustic Testing Facility, Callaghan Innovation and other professionals to guide our research.
